Surnames: LANE Classification: Query Message Board URL: http://boards.ancestry.com/mbexec/msg/rw/Sc.2ADI/269.1.1.2 Message Board Post: As it turns out my Wiley LANE was of Dooly Co., GA. I do not know how he is related to the Houston Co., GA. Lanes. I believe Wiley had a sibling named Franklin aka Frank. Franklin m. a Mary Jane Unknown and their issues were William R., James Augustus and Frances C. 1840 Federal Census Lain, Franklin State: Georgia Year: 1840 County: Dooly Roll: M704_40 Township: District 10 Page: 89 Image: 181 Lain, Franklin male: 1 age 20-30 female: 1 age 15-20 ------------------------------------------- 1850 Federal Census 11 Sept. 1850 Lane, Franklin State: Georgia County: Dooly Roll: M432_68 Township: 24Th District Page: 249 Image: 45 LANE, Franklin age 30 b. GA. carpenter Mary Jane 28 GA. William R. 6 GA. James A. 4 GA. 1860... Gus A. ? Frances C. 3 GA. female FOUNTAIN, Susan 20 b. GA. ------------------------------------------ 1860 Federal Census 13 August 1860 Drayton, Dooly Co., GA. page 89/503 Roll 119 Book 1 LANE, Frank 43 GA. carpenter M. G. 41 GA. female W. R. 16 GA. male Jas A. 14 GA. F?le 12 GA. female ------------------------------------------- Janice janb111@aol.com
